User Experience Comparison: Macbook Air M3 Vs Zenbook 14X For Coding And Debugging

Choosing the right laptop for coding and debugging is essential for developers and students alike. The Macbook Air M3 and the Zenbook 14x are two popular options, each with unique features that impact user experience. This article compares these devices to help you make an informed decision.

Design and Build Quality

The Macbook Air M3 boasts a sleek, lightweight aluminum chassis, making it highly portable. Its minimalist design and premium feel appeal to users who prioritize aesthetics and durability. The Zenbook 14x features a stylish aluminum body with a slightly larger footprint, offering a balance between portability and a more spacious keyboard layout.

Display and Screen Real Estate

The Macbook Air M3 has a 13.6-inch Retina display with True Tone technology, providing vibrant colors and sharp details. Its high resolution enhances the clarity of code and debugging interfaces. The Zenbook 14x offers a 14-inch OLED display with a higher resolution, delivering deeper blacks and more vivid colors, which can reduce eye strain during long coding sessions.

Keyboard and Trackpad

Both laptops feature excellent keyboards suited for extensive typing. The Macbook Air M3’s Magic Keyboard provides a comfortable typing experience with good key travel. The Zenbook 14x’s keyboard is spacious with well-placed keys, offering tactile feedback. The trackpads on both devices are large and responsive, supporting multi-touch gestures that streamline coding workflows.

Performance and Speed

The Macbook Air M3 is powered by Apple’s latest M3 chip, delivering impressive speed and energy efficiency. It handles complex debugging tools and multiple applications seamlessly. The Zenbook 14x features an AMD Ryzen or Intel Core processor, providing robust performance suitable for coding and debugging tasks, though it may consume more power and generate more heat under load.

Operating System and Software Compatibility

The Macbook Air runs macOS, known for its stability and developer-friendly environment, especially for iOS and MacOS app development. The Zenbook runs Windows 11, offering broader compatibility with various development tools and software, including many enterprise and open-source applications.

Battery Life

The Macbook Air M3 excels in battery longevity, often exceeding 15 hours on a single charge, making it ideal for long coding sessions without needing frequent recharges. The Zenbook 14x provides around 8-12 hours depending on usage, which is still respectable but may require more frequent charging during intensive debugging.

Connectivity and Ports

The Macbook Air M3 has a limited port selection, primarily featuring Thunderbolt 4/USB-C ports, requiring adapters for other connections. The Zenbook 14x offers a variety of ports, including USB-A, HDMI, and Thunderbolt, providing greater flexibility for connecting peripherals without additional accessories.

Price and Value

Pricing varies significantly, with the Macbook Air M3 positioned as a premium device with a higher price point. The Zenbook 14x tends to be more affordable, offering excellent performance and features suitable for budget-conscious developers. Both devices provide good value depending on the user’s specific needs and ecosystem preferences.

Conclusion

For developers invested in the Apple ecosystem or prioritizing battery life and design, the Macbook Air M3 is an excellent choice. Its seamless integration and macOS stability enhance the coding and debugging experience. Conversely, the Zenbook 14x offers greater flexibility with ports, a vibrant display, and compatibility with Windows-based tools, making it suitable for a broader range of development environments. Consider your specific workflow, software needs, and budget when choosing between these two powerful laptops.
